Origin of amphibian and avian chromosomes by fission, fusion, and retention of ancestral chromosomes

Amphibian genomes differ greatly in DNA content and chromosome size, morphology, and number. Investigations of this diversity are needed to identify mechanisms that have shaped the evolution of vertebrate genomes.
